About А. Б. Бабенко

А. Б. Бабенко is a scholar working on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Oceanography, Global and Planetary Change, Ecology and Genetics, having authored 62 papers that have together received 412 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Collembola Taxonomy and Ecology Studies (55 papers), Marine and environmental studies (26 papers), Hemiptera Insect Studies (12 papers), Study of Mite Species (11 papers), Bryophyte Studies and Records (7 papers), Invertebrate Taxonomy and Ecology (7 papers), Fire effects on ecosystems (7 papers) and Radioactive contamination and transfer (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ics (258 cit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(109 citations), Ecological Modeling (17 citations), Oceanography (46 citations) and Geology (19 citations). А. Б. Бабенко has collaborated with scholars based in Russia, Japan and New Zealand. Frequent co-authors include Victor Lempitsky, Arne Fjellberg, Mikhail Potapov, О. Л. Макарова, Sergey G. Ermilov, I. D. Hodkinson, Valerie M. Behan‐Pelletier, Maria A. Minor, Alexander A. Khaustov and А. А. Таскаева. Their work appears in journals such as Zootaxa, ZooKeys, Polar Biology, Arctic Antarctic and Alpine Research and Pedobiologia.
